Further Signs of Deflation

Not only did retail sales fall in March, but wholesale prices fell as well:

"Meanwhile, the Labor Department reported that wholesale prices plunged 1.2 percent in March as the cost of gasoline, other energy products and food fell sharply."

Business inventories also fell for a sixth straight month, making it the longest stretch of declining inventories in seven years.
